In my opinion, the best and quickest way to remedy this is to order the part you need from S&W directly, or you could order from Brownell or Midway if the factory doesn't have the part in stock (unlikely), or won't sell it to you without you sending it to the factory for installation - which I also think is unlikely. The part is fairly inexpensive if you want MIM. For stainless, it will cost you more. I've never lost a thumb piece from any of my revolvers, but I have read more than a few messages on this forum of those who have. I think this calls for Loc-tite when you install your replacement thumb piece.
